Public Affairs Specialist

As a PUBLIC AFFAIRS SPECIALIST
-T32, GS-1035-11, you will assist the state's Public Affairs (PA) Officer at the strategic and operational level, with particular emphasis on developing segments of more complicated or sensitive communications campaigns and executing the National Guard Bureau's (NGB's) communication objectives.

Duties and responsibilities include:

  • Assisting the Public Affairs Officer in the formulation of long-range plans and policies to enhance public understanding, support and acceptance of Public Affairs programs and/or activities statewide.
  • Researching and developing informational materials and complete communication campaigns for release to audiences through electronic and newspaper media. Prepared materials explain or describe the mission of the NG, NG accomplishments, policies, programs or actions taken to ensure the NG's compliance with state and federal regulatory requirements. Written materials include news releases, display advertisements, fact sheets, feature stories, background statements, special reports, etc.
  • Responding to media requests for information of both a routine and controversial nature. Preparing or assembling information kits, editing informational materials drafted by subordinate public affairs specialists or unit UPAR's, releasing photographs and/or feature stories to the news media, coordinating media interviews with NG subject matter experts and arranging photographic and electronic media coverage of newsworthy NG events.
  • Maintaining close working relationships with officials of various civic, media and community groups and Department of Defense personnel, as well as state and national government officials outside the NG.
  • Creating new or adapting or modifying accepted communication campaign formats to reach a target audience with a specific message. The selection of a communication campaign format is based on an analysis of targeted audience demographics and message content. After an informational campaign has been implemented, solicited and unsolicited response data is gathered to assess campaign effectiveness in reaching the target audience.
  • Primary manager for the agency's official Federal website, ensuring timely, accurate, and compliant content updates within the AFPIMS platform. Experience working in AFPIMS
    -or similar government web content management systems-is highly desired to support effective digital communication and public engagement.
  • Performing other duties as assigned.
